1. Did spectators cost VanDam…
…the win at Chickamauga? He'd never say that but:
- Fact: Spectator boats aren't going away.
- Fact: KVD gets more of them than most.
- Fact: He has to set his tournament strategy with that in mind – so it's not the best fishing strategy, but the best "fishing with 50 boats around you" strategy.
From that article:
> After the first two rounds, VanDam was a threat to win it all at BASSfest. On Saturday, a floating gallery of 50 spectator boats greeted him at the ledge shared with Jeff Kriet and Russ Lane.
> That day, VanDam would return with one bass shy of a limit. Four bass on the scales can make or break a winning effort. It did for VanDam at BASSfest.
> “I’ll think about that day for a long time,” he said. “It killed my chances because I had a really good shot at the win.”

Tip of the Day
> …he’s learned there is one constant factor when tournaments are won on river channel ledges…current.
> …making precision casts while keeping watch on the graph display.
> VanDam learned that current speed, not just the current itself, is the determining factor for how fish set up on a ledge. “The speed of flow concentrated the fish more to a particular side of that piece of cover. You had to put the bait precisely on that sweet spot.”
> The “sweet spot” moved around a lot at BASSfest. “Every time the current moved, the bass were on a different spot. You had to constantly adjust to where they were setting up on the ledge cover.”
